Water damage is often indicated by a rotting frame, sash, or muntin. This should be repaired as soon as is possible. These damages allow hot air to escape during the summer and frigid air in during the winter, which makes it difficult for you and your family members to live comfortably.

In many cases the local window repair professional can make these repairs without having to replace the entire window. They can scrape the old putty off of the frames and clean them using a wire brush, then sand and apply wood sealer. They can also replace the sash and muntins depending on the look and functionality of your windows. They can also enhance the look of your home by painting your windows. Local window repair businesses can give you an estimate in person. The quote will typically include the following:

Labor costs. The cost of labor will vary depending on the area. Cities with higher rates of employment are generally more costly than rural areas. The number of windows in your home will also impact the labor rate. If you have lots of windows that need to be repaired it will take more time than when you have fewer windows.

Equipment and materials. The type of materials used to construct your window will impact the price, as will the kind of work needed. For instance, if have wood window frames with rotting muntins or mullions They may need to be replaced. These are decorative elements that are inserted between glass panes. You can replace them if they're not in good working order without having to replace the entire window.

Other costs. This could include delivery and pickup charges for materials; costs to prepare the site, including protecting surfaces such as finishes, structures, or equipment as well as an hourly minimum cost and inspections or permits depending on the project. Some firms window and door repair include the cost of overhead and markup for a general contractor in addition to the above. This is a legitimate expense that should be included in any estimate.
